VAKRA (arXiv 2608.12282) benchmarks agents against 8,000+ executable APIs across 62 domains, verifying by re-executing predicted calls against live endpoints. Accuracy falls to 50-51% on compositional APIs and degrades over 50% as depth grows. Failures concentrate in entity disambiguation and cross-source grounding, not tool invocation mechanics, so retries and better function schemas won't move these numbers.
